Ingredients for Ranch Hummus

For the Hummus Base
Chick Peas Use canned for a quick and creamy texture (2 cans, 15 oz each).
Olive Oil Adds richness; you can substitute with avocado oil if desired.
Tahini (optional) Enhances creaminess; if unavailable, feel free to omit.
Fresh Lemon Juice Brightens up the dip; fresh is best for flavor.
Fresh Garlic Provides a robust taste; peel and use one clove.
Hidden Valley® Original Ranch® Seasoning Mix Infuses the signature ranch flavor (2 packets, 1 oz each).
Water Helps achieve your desired dip consistency; add as needed for smoothness.
Chopped Fresh Parsley Perfect for garnishing and adding freshness to your ranch hummus.

How to Make Ranch Hummus

  1. Combine Ingredients: In a food processor, add drained chick peas, olive oil, optional tahini, fresh lemon juice, minced garlic, and Hidden Valley® Original Ranch® seasoning mix. This is the base of your creamy dip!

  2. Blend Smoothly: Start blending the mixture, gradually pouring in 1/4 cup of water. Process for about 4 minutes until the mixture is perfectly smooth and creamy.

  3. Adjust Consistency: If it’s too thick, add water a tablespoon at a time until you reach your preferred texture. Keep in mind it may thicken a bit as it sits.

  4. Plate and Garnish: Scoop your finished ranch hummus into a bowl, creating a beautiful swirl on the top. Drizzle a little olive oil over it and sprinkle with chopped fresh parsley to add a pop of color.

  5. Chill Before Serving: Store the hummus in the refrigerator until you’re ready to serve. For the best flavor, allow it to chill for at least 30 minutes!

Optional: Serve with a colorful array of fresh veggies or pita chips for a delightful snacking experience.

How to Store and Freeze Ranch Hummus

Fridge: Keep your Ranch Hummus in an airtight container for up to 3-5 days. For best flavor, cover it tightly to prevent it from absorbing other fridge odors.

Freezer: You can freeze Ranch Hummus for up to 3 months. Use a freezer-safe container, leaving some space at the top as it may expand when frozen.

Thawing: To enjoy frozen hummus, transfer it to the fridge overnight to thaw. Stir well before serving, and add a splash of water if needed for consistency.

Reheating: While it s best served cold, if you prefer it warmed, gently heat in the microwave on low until just warm, stirring to avoid overheating.

Expert Tips for Ranch Hummus

Chill for Flavor: Ensure to refrigerate the hummus for at least 30 minutes before serving to enhance the ranch flavors beautifully.

Consistency Control: If the dip thickens over time, simply add a tablespoon of water to achieve your desired smoothness before serving.

Check Ingredient Quality: Use fresh garlic and high-quality olive oil for the best possible taste in your Ranch Hummus.

Avoid Over-Blending: Be careful not to over-blend the chickpeas; it can make the dip too gummy. Blend just until creamy!

Try Flavor Variations: Don t hesitate to experiment different spices or roasted veggies can add a unique twist to your Ranch Hummus.

Make Ahead Options

These Ranch Hummus delights are perfect for busy home cooks seeking meal prep ease! You can prepare the entire hummus mixture up to 24 hours in advance; simply store it in an airtight container in the refrigerator. To maintain its creamy texture, be sure to drizzle a bit of olive oil on top and cover it with Glad® Press n Seal Wrap® or a fitted lid. When you’re ready to serve, just give it a good stir and add a splash of water to adjust the consistency if required. Ranch Hummus Recipe FAQs

How do I select the best chickpeas for my Ranch Hummus?
When choosing chickpeas, I recommend using canned ones for convenience. Look for options that are labeled “no salt added” or “low sodium” for a healthier choice. If you’re using dried chickpeas, soak them overnight and cook until tender before blending.

What is the best way to store Ranch Hummus?
For optimal freshness, store your Ranch Hummus in an airtight container in the refrigerator. It will last for about 3 to 5 days. To retain its wonderful flavors, seal it tightly to prevent absorption of other odors from your fridge.

Can I freeze Ranch Hummus?
Absolutely! You can freeze Ranch Hummus for up to 3 months. Simply place it in a freezer-safe container, leaving about an inch of space at the top for expansion. When you’re ready to enjoy it, thaw it overnight in the refrigerator.

What should I do if my Ranch Hummus is too thick?
If your Ranch Hummus turns out thicker than you’d like, no worries! Gradually add water, a tablespoon at a time, while blending until you reach your desired consistency. It s normal for the hummus to thicken as it sits, so adding a little water before serving can help.
